         <title>Use your analysis of the performance task claims, targets, and standards to reflect on instructional implications.</title>
         <author>jgerosa1</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/jgerosa1/6ju65nju11v02nxt/wish/2010163418</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ul><li>Consider the proficiencies outlined on the rubric aligned to the ELA Interim Performance Task. How does your feedback to students on in-class writing tasks align with these performance indicators?</li><li>How are you providing a balance of instructional tasks at each DOK level, ensuring students get to extended thinking tasks?</li><li>What do you anticipate students farthest from the sphere of success will need to build towards these skill proficiencies?</li></ul><div><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>After previewing the task overall, reflect on implications for your planning and instruction.</title>
         <author>jgerosa1</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/jgerosa1/6ju65nju11v02nxt/wish/2010164323</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ul><li>Are my texts sufficiently complex?</li><li>Are my questions text-dependent and do they lead to key understandings of the text?</li><li>Am I providing students with multiple opportunities to build stamina with independent reading and writing?</li></ul><div><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>6th Grade - Haley</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/jgerosa1/6ju65nju11v02nxt/wish/2014726275</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>-I feel like I have used a variety of complex texts. They are not texts my students have easily read through. We have done a lot of in-class reading, as I have found it important to allow students to question the text as a whole group, and allow other students to respond. If they don't have an idea/answer to suggest, I will help students so they can better understand the text.<br>-I believe a majority of the questions I have asked my students to answer this year are text-dependent, at least when it comes to written assignments. I am trying to do better at asking students to cite textual evidence out loud during discussion time.<br>-My last two units, I have had students complete journal entries as a way to practice writing every day. We read multiple texts in the first and third units, and one large grounding text in the second unit. When we have study groups, I like to use that time to allow students to work on homework or late assignments, and if they have nothing to work on, they should be reading.</div>]]></description>
